摘要:
1.创建mybatis-config.xml进行环境配置、全局设置、Mapper声明及其他配置信息 2.在初始化工具类MyBatisUtils中,通过SqlSessionFactoryBuilder.build() 创建一个全局唯一的SqlSessionFactory对象 3.通过SqlSessio 阅读全文
posted @ 2022-04-08 20:21
南风知君
阅读(542)
评论(0)
推荐(0)
摘要:
Mapper XML <insert id="insert" parameterType="com.MyBatis.entity.Goods"> INSERT INTO t_goods(title,sub_title,original_cost,current_price,discount,is_f 阅读全文
posted @ 2022-04-08 19:38
南风知君
阅读(35)
评论(0)
推荐(0)
摘要:
ResultMap可以将查询结果映射为复杂类型的Java对象 ResultMap适用于java对象保存多表关联结果 ResultMap支持对象关联查询等高级操作 扩展出一个对象对查询结果进行保存 创建一个dto包src-main-java-com-MyBatis-dto dto是一个特殊的JavaB 阅读全文
posted @ 2022-04-08 16:46
南风知君
阅读(153)
评论(0)
推荐(0)
摘要:
<!--利用LinkedHashMap保存多表关联结果 MyBatis会将每一条记录包装为LinkedHashMap对象 key是字段名 value是字段对应的值,字段类型根据表结构进行自动判断 优点:易于拓展,易于使用 缺点:太过灵活,无法进行编译时检查--> <select id="select 阅读全文
posted @ 2022-04-08 14:53
南风知君
阅读(76)
评论(0)
推荐(0)
摘要:
SQL传参有两种形式 首先在Mapper XML中编写<select>标签并书写SQL语句 <!--单参数传参,使用parameterType指定参数的数据类型,SQL中#{value}提取参数--> <select id="selectById" parameterType="Integer" r 阅读全文
posted @ 2022-04-08 14:29
南风知君
阅读(570)
评论(0)
推荐(0)

浙公网安备 33010602011771号